Planktonic foraminifera counts of sediment core MD95-2042 off the Iberian margin for the past 60 ka ...

Absolute abundance data of planktonic foraminifera of sediment core MD95-2042 (3146 m water depth) off the Western Iberian margin for the past 60 ka. Counts were performed within the coarse sedimentary fraction (>150 µm) and a minimum of 300 specimens were counted per sample. Harmonized taxonomy...
